What do you have against real performance?
Look at Airframe, and estimate the file size and required hardware for playback
of a FL* version, with the whole screen in motion because it's a flythrough,
not just a dif against a static background. It's something like 6 minutes long.
And it includes nonstop audio, accurately synchronized to the action. And of
course it incorporates the player and driver code in the single exe.
It's a 60k file. 60k, not 60 megs. And it plays fine full frame on a 386-20
laptop with 4 year old video. Try that in Windows. I'll even grant you the
filespace overhead of the entire Windows GUI, because you need it to play
Solitaire.
>>How about the Gates warp in EMF's demo? Bitmaps!<<
Of course it's a bitmap. Who was dissing bitmaps? It's 1 bitmap with real time
manipulation. Do that sequence as a FL* and it'd be bigger than the entire
demo.
FL* is a great format for development. So is an uncompressed TGA file.
